Airline Compliance

Worried about flights? The 73.26Wh battery is under the 100Wh airline limit, so you can keep it onboard after detaching it from the shell. Just slide it out—it’s tool-free—and tuck it in your carry-on. No hidden fees or rejections; this meets global standards like IATA rules. Always confirm with your airline, but Airwheel nails this part so you won’t sweat security checks.

Q: Can I remove the battery for flights? A: Yes—the 73.26Wh battery detaches in seconds and complies with airline rules. Just pack it in your carry-on. Q: Do I need the app to ride it? A: Nope. Basic riding works out of the box; the app is optional for minor tweaks like speed adjustments. Q: Are solar panels feasible for future models? A: Unlikely soon. Current solar tech would need a large panel (impractical on a 20L shell) and generates minimal power in shade or cloudy weather—slowing you down more than charging. Airwheel prioritizes reliability over unproven add-ons.
